Commit graph

517 commits

Author SHA1 Message Date
Thibault Duplessis f942359b34 idempotent migration script 2016-12-08 00:21:32 +01:00
Thibault Duplessis 40066caf79 more work on puzzle UI 2016-12-08 00:17:45 +01:00
Thibault Duplessis c0bad625a6 mongo script to fix puzzle FEN full move number 2016-12-06 17:09:09 +01:00
Thibault Duplessis 690640cf2c fix build-deps 2016-12-02 23:52:46 +01:00
Thibault Duplessis 21ff79bb84 fork Kamon to fix influxdb zeroes 2016-12-02 15:45:03 +01:00
Thibault Duplessis 5476bd1b17 Merge branch 'master' into puzzle2
* master: (67 commits)
  enable kamon influxdb backend
  add player users infos to UserGameApi - for #2397
  formatting
  fix unmoved rook persistence after takeback
  uz "oʻzbekcha" translation #16974. Author: VMN91.
  Add source to UserGameApi JSON
  upgrade scalachess to fix FEN tests
  upgrade scalachess
  upgrade scalachess
  ca "Català, valencià" translation #16972. Author: garciagil. (285/534): A preposition in the sentence about the time taken for quiz solution. I replaces "amb"(with) with "en" (in) xxx minutes. Plus a couple of minor changes on verbal tenses.
  tr "Türkçe" translation #16971. Author: katakamata.
  antiches san with # means loss
  fix deploy script
  play & analyse antichess
  upgrade scalachess
  update assets version
  complete unmoved rooks persistence - closes #2392
  tweak perf tests
  test and optimize unmoved rooks serializer performances
  update sf and enable ceval for antichess
  ...
2016-11-18 19:18:26 +01:00
Thibault Duplessis 2246ff2977 fix deploy script 2016-11-15 13:59:43 +01:00
Thibault Duplessis 968efd9f1f remove puzzle difficulty preference 2016-11-07 16:22:27 +01:00
Thibault Duplessis 9e2613cff4 Merge branch 'master' into puzzle2
* master: (599 commits)
  refresh chessground after mobile deep-link
  ring the correspondence alarm sooner, for dev purposes
  implement server-side correspondence time up alarm
  fix including all kamon trace segments
  inc assets version
  sk "slovenčina" translation #16954. Author: MajkySL.
  ru "русский язык" translation #16953. Author: Vasaka. Предыдущий вариант не помещается, не виден целиком. Последнее слово не видно. Не понятно к чему призывают.
  try to fix missing kamon trace segments
  fix tournament player box - closes #2379
  fix tournament schedule - closes #2378
  more tournament standing CSS tweak
  add support for watcher chat in mobile API
  discard mistyped whispers
  update donation goal
  again, chrome bug with table td opacity & background
  rewrite berserk alert CSS too
  improve moretime button CSS
  complete berserk button rewrite
  add more data to mod export API - closes #2372
  more tournament standing UI tweaks
  ...
2016-11-07 15:12:08 +01:00
Thibault Duplessis fddd7b149b tweak client compilation 2016-11-06 10:33:02 +01:00
Thibault Duplessis 9112def714 script to fix forum categ DB types 2016-11-03 12:19:25 +01:00
Thibault Duplessis d08af1233c console log latest commit sha1 - closes #2360 2016-11-02 09:29:06 +01:00
Thibault Duplessis c16187a2d6 rename closure-compiler call 2016-11-01 17:59:43 +01:00
Thibault Duplessis b8bd8e3015 fix JS build 2016-10-07 20:32:02 +02:00
Thibault Duplessis 1d3b394587 tweak JS build 2016-10-07 19:29:48 +02:00
Thibault Duplessis ab90ddc270 tweak deploy script 2016-10-02 23:11:04 +02:00
Thibault Duplessis ebb83e99d9 tweak puzzle script 2016-10-02 18:13:55 +02:00
clarkerubber a6ed504a07 Script to disable bad mate puzzles 2016-10-02 17:54:01 +02:00
Thibault Duplessis ef2d5d39f3 tweak puzzle disabler script 2016-09-30 14:24:01 +02:00
Thibault Duplessis 5e8c4d1fd5 tweak puzzle disabler script 2016-09-30 12:32:40 +02:00
Thibault Duplessis 3a1c126410 mongo script to copy old good puzzles to new IDs 2016-09-29 18:53:13 +02:00
Thibault Duplessis 1db2d9e662 mongo script to copy old good puzzles to new IDs 2016-09-29 16:04:18 +02:00
Thibault Duplessis 5ebd8a4549 tweak puzzle disabler 2016-09-29 11:03:49 +02:00
Thibault Duplessis d6c0cfa752 Merge branch 'master' into puzzle2
* master: (143 commits)
  only select new puzzles - closes #2284 - REVERT ME
  cache anon homepage twice longer
  tweak wording
  delay notification computation and add line wrap
  improve move notifications - closes #2206
  inc assets version
  threat mode fixes
  hide threats when disabling local evaluation manually
  honor study analysis setting in threat mode
  can't show the threat with a check on the board
  mention the new show threat feature in analysis keyboard help
  analysis threat mode proof of concept
  feature titled player simul regardless of classic. rating - closes #2280
  global nofollow meta tag
  fix analysis menu form button size
  analysis menu dark & transp themes
  found unused CSS selectors
  more analysis menu fixes
  remove 2 superfluous div.col
  simplify CSS selectors
  ...
2016-09-29 10:55:49 +02:00
Thibault Duplessis 2903d1dc1c Merge branch 'master' into rm012
* master: (760 commits)
  remove user mod blindfold indicator
  remove unused stuff
  Allow CSRF WS for BC (lichess4545) - REVERT ME
  protect WS endpoints against CSRF - for #2270
  restrict API WS abilities
  API websocket endpoint - closes #2270
  support very short youtube URLs
  inc assets version
  cv "чӑваш чӗлхи" translation #16850. Author: pentille.
  better cache homepage
  Allow filling in the import form via GET
  improve logging
  can't monitor negative puzzle votes
  inc assets version
  ar "العربية" translation #16849. Author: asibahi. Plenty of spelling fixes, terminology fixes, making sure nouns ar ethe same across the board. Some sentences flow better. Generally less text.
  de "Deutsch" translation #16848. Author: raging_rook. just modified a few minor inaccuracies: full featured: keine Einschränkung[EN], lit.: no restriction[s]. I changed "umsonst" to "gratis" because it's a more common phrase in this context. "aus der Liebe zum Schach" sounds wrong and artificial, therefore, I dropped the article "der". Insight data = player stats? If that's the case, then "persönliche Spielerstatistiken", Klicke [aud] den libnk, because that's just the correct way to say it.l
  az "Azərbaycanca" translation #16846. Author: Jeyhun. Thank you! Lichess #1 chess website!
  cv "чӑваш чӗлхи" translation #16844. Author: pentille.
  improve logging wip
  refactor JS storage
  ...
2016-09-23 12:40:09 +02:00
Thibault Duplessis 2207afc982 fix puzzle-disable-endgames.js and backup previous vote 2016-09-20 12:59:49 +02:00
clarkerubber a6dd85564e increase endgame piece count limit 2016-09-19 23:56:01 +10:00
clarkerubber e21bb8e3d4 script for disabling endgame puzzles 2016-09-19 23:24:01 +10:00
clarkerubber 4644f41ca0 fix multiple votes bug 2016-09-19 05:03:37 +10:00
Thibault Duplessis 5993329c69 fix deploy-assets 2016-09-14 09:27:10 +02:00
Thibault Duplessis 4db5e22d89 deploy assets without recompiling JS 2016-09-08 12:17:10 +02:00
Thibault Duplessis 74887afc2e new "letter" piece set by usolando 2016-08-29 15:39:58 +02:00
Thibault Duplessis 882460c2fd faster restart 2016-08-11 07:32:46 +02:00
Thibault Duplessis 9fd4fbb898 Merge branch 'master' into rm012
* master:
  upgrade jquery to 3.1.0
  remove unused file
  remove debug
  upgrade chessground for greater hyperbullet accuracy
  make dark theme fonts a bit brighter
  tweak analysis opening box style
  better limit tree view width
  fix prod-only bug where fen tag is null
  limit tree view size
  make analysis tree view a bit larger when screen size allows it
  tweak function visibility
  parallel compilation of mithril modules
2016-07-28 17:07:29 +02:00
Thibault Duplessis 8cd48cfa66 remove unused file 2016-07-28 16:56:35 +02:00
Thibault Duplessis dd9e84e828 Merge remote-tracking branch 'cchantep/rm-0.12-RC0' into rm012
* cchantep/rm-0.12-RC0:
  Upgrade to ReactiveMongo 0.12 (Release Candidate 0)
2016-07-27 12:12:59 +02:00
Thibault Duplessis 55722ada87 exit on OOM in dev env 2016-07-26 03:58:57 +02:00
cchantep 663ade5a93 Upgrade to ReactiveMongo 0.12 (Release Candidate 0) 2016-07-21 14:41:34 +02:00
Thibault Duplessis ae4b6a80fe update patron migration script 2016-07-18 21:03:39 +02:00
Thibault Duplessis ed0dbee8f8 convert donation to DB charges 2016-07-14 21:31:41 +02:00
Thibault Duplessis 2bfaaa226c donor to patron DB script 2016-07-14 19:24:53 +02:00
Thibault Duplessis fc70c56b2b quietly deploy to stage 2016-07-10 15:03:59 +02:00
Thibault Duplessis f5abb656d3 Merge pull request #2046 from niklasf/remove-install-stockfish
Remove bin/install-stockfish from pre fishnet time
2016-06-25 11:06:43 +02:00
Jimmie Elvenmark 323878f978 hardcode vagrant ip in instructions
This doesn't work with PredictableNetworkInterfaceNames, no need trying to be smart when it's hardcoded in Vagrantfile
2016-06-25 00:42:55 +02:00
Niklas Fiekas 1a41eb2c0a Remove bin/install-stockfish from pre fishnet time 2016-06-24 21:58:17 +02:00
Niklas Fiekas 1285e7b57a Vagrant: Remove duplicate hostnames 2016-06-24 21:40:33 +02:00
Niklas Fiekas a6ceb2432d Update Vagrantfile with recent config changes 2016-06-11 14:41:55 +02:00
Niklas Fiekas bafbea08f9 HTTPS adjustments and fixes 2016-06-08 19:15:12 +02:00
Thibault Duplessis 92f989c4e8 support for WSS 2016-06-08 19:14:28 +02:00
Thibault Duplessis 60599fc71b stage deployment slack notifications 2016-05-31 12:01:50 +02:00